次の方法で共有


MINIPORT_WDI_RX_STOP コールバック関数 (dot11wdi.h)

重要

このトピックは、Windows 10でリリースされた WDI ドライバー モデルの一部です。 WDI ドライバー モデルはメンテナンス モードであり、優先度の高い修正のみを受け取ります。 WiFiCx は、Windows 11でリリースされた Wi-Fi ドライバー モデルです。 最新の機能を利用するには、WiFiCx を使用することをお勧めします。

MiniportWdiRxStop ハンドラー関数は、特定のポートで RX を停止し、ワイルドカード ポート ID を受け入れてアダプター全体で RX を停止します。 TAL は、要求を成功状態で完了するか、保留中の状態で完了し、 RxStopConfirm を非同期的に示すことによって、RX 停止操作を完了します。

これは、 NDIS_MINIPORT_WDI_DATA_HANDLERS内の WDI ミニポート ハンドラーです。

指示を完了する前に、選択したポートまたはアダプター全体で新しいトラフィックを示すのを停止するようにターゲットを構成する必要があります。

この要求は、低電力 (アダプター) と dot11 リセット (ポート) への移行の一環として TAL に発行されます。

メモMINIPORT_WDI_RX_STOP型を使用して関数を宣言する必要があります。 詳細については、次の例に関するセクションを参照してください。
 

構文

MINIPORT_WDI_RX_STOP MiniportWdiRxStop;

void MiniportWdiRxStop(
  [in]  TAL_TXRX_HANDLE MiniportTalTxRxContext,
  [in]  WDI_PORT_ID PortId,
  [out] NDIS_STATUS *pWifiStatus
)
{...}

パラメーター

[in] MiniportTalTxRxContext

ミニポートWdiTalTxRxInitialize の IHV ミニポートによって返される TAL デバイス ハンドル。

[in] PortId

ポート ID。

[out] pWifiStatus

IHV ミニポートからの状態。 成功状態は、操作が同期的に完了したことを示します。 保留中の状態は、停止が非同期的に確認されることを示します。

戻り値

なし

必要条件

要件
サポートされている最小のクライアント Windows 10
サポートされている最小のサーバー Windows Server 2016
対象プラットフォーム Windows
ヘッダー dot11wdi.h

こちらもご覧ください

NDIS_MINIPORT_WDI_DATA_HANDLERS

TAL_TXRX_HANDLE

WDI RX パス

WDI_PORT_ID